Francesca Siclari is a scholar working on Cognitive Neuroscience, Experimental and Cognitive Psychology and Endocrine and Autonomic Systems. According to data from OpenAlex, Francesca Siclari has authored 49 papers receiving a total of 2.0k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 37 papers in Cognitive Neuroscience, 22 papers in Experimental and Cognitive Psychology and 7 papers in Endocrine and Autonomic Systems. Recurrent topics in Francesca Siclari's work include Sleep and Wakefulness Research (34 papers), Sleep and related disorders (22 papers) and Neural dynamics and brain function (14 papers). Francesca Siclari is often cited by papers focused on Sleep and Wakefulness Research (34 papers), Sleep and related disorders (22 papers) and Neural dynamics and brain function (14 papers). Francesca Siclari collaborates with scholars based in Switzerland, Italy and United States. Francesca Siclari's co-authors include Giulio Tononi, Giulio Bernardi, Joshua J. LaRocque, Brady A. Riedner, Bradley R. Postle, Jacinthe Cataldi, Monica Betta, Emiliano Ricciardi, Mélanie Boly and Pietro Pietrini and has published in prestigious journals such as Nature Communications, Journal of Neuroscience and Nature Neuroscience.
